We’re pleased to announce a significant enhancement to the eLxr Mirror Tracker project, the dashboard is available at https://elxr-mirror-tracker-532e68.gitlab.io. The project now includes automated installation testing results for all changed/updated packages.
What’s New
We’ve integrated installation testing directly into the Mirror Tracker workflow, enabling the testing team to validate package changes automatically. The system now:
-
Monitors package changes - Continuously tracks added, removed, and updated packages across different dates
-
Triggers automated tests - Automatically initiates installation tests for changed packages
-
Validates across architectures - Tests package installation success on multiple target architectures
-
Displays test results - Shows installation testing outcomes in the last column of the project
How It Works
When the Mirror Tracker detects package changes (additions, removals, or updates), it automatically:
-
Identifies the specific packages that changed
-
Triggers installation tests targeting only those changed packages
-
Validates installation success across different architectures
-
Updates the project with test results in real-time
